This isn't a huge earth-shattering problem or anything, but there is a ton of valuable info posted here and a lot of times it relies on images that were pulled directly from third party sites or from temporary hosting sites like imgur or photobucket. After several years most of those links are broken, so old posts here tend to be filled with missing images.
Since we're apparently a bunch of nostalgic weirdos here on VOGONS, it probably isn't a stretch to assume that most of us STILL HAVE pictures we would have uploaded a decade ago or more, so we are likely the only ones capable of restoring the usefulness of posts we made in the past that have broken image links. The majority of pictures these days are attached to posts so this is more of a problem with posts from several years ago when more people used external hosting.
To make it easier to go through your post history, you can do this:
1. Go to advanced search. (Magnifying glass > Gear)
2. Enter a keyword that is relevant to any image hosting sites you may have used in the past: imgur, photobucket, tinypic, abload, dropbox, imagehosting, imageshack, etc. Or, just "IMG" since that will bring up any image embeds you have used (though probably a lot of irrelevant posts too).
3. Enter your username for the the author of the post.
If you think you still have any of the pictures mentioned in the posts, insert updated links or just attach the images directly to the post if possible.
If even a small percentage of the broken image links on this site can be restored it will be very helpful to anyone who finds our post when doing research in the future.
